Question
What is Brownian movement?
✓
Answer
Brownian Movement : When viewed through an ultramicroscope, colloidal particles are seen continuously moving in a zig-zag way. Robert Brown in 1827 observed such a movement of pollen grains suspended in water and hence, it is called Brownian movement.
